I always enjoy the ALAN workshop. Meeting the authors of Young Adult Literature and receiving copies of their books is a real treat. In my box of books I found a copy of Deadline, Crutcher's latest novel.

This book grabbed me from the first page. Ben Walker is diagnosed with an incurable disease and makes the decision to not tell anyone; not his parents, not his brother, not his friends. And then this gutsy, small-of-stature cross country star decides to go out for football instead. The rest of the book gives us a peek at how he lives out the last year of his life. The book has mature language, but young adult readers will empathize with the challenges and obstacles Ben faces with humor and dignity.
